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om South San Jose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in South San Jose with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in South San Jose is at 164 S 10th St listed at $1,240.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om South San Jose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in South San Jose is $3,293.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om South San Jose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in South San Jose is a 1,218 square feet unit starting from $4,249 at Revere Campbell.

What is the average size for South San Jose 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in South San Jose is currently 746 sq ft.
